Variations in adult BMI among Indian men: a quantile regression analysis
Archana Agnihotri1, Brinda Viswanathan1
1Madras School of Economics, Kotturpuram, Chennai600025, TN, India.
Abstract:
India has not only maintained its top position among countries with the largest number of underweight adults but has also jumped to a higher position among countries with largest increase in the proportion of overweight people in the last three decades. More studies focus on double burden of malnutrition among women than on men. This study uses the quantile regression model to analyse the covariates associated with low and high body mass index (BMI) primarily among men aged 20-54 years during 2015-2016 in India. Occupations that involve more manual work help in maintaining a normal BMI along with better education, dietary diversity, and less sedentary lifestyle. A gendered comparison of men and their spouses highlights the differences in the association of covariates with BMI for men and women. The results from this study will provide insights for behavioural change at an individual level and inputs for public health intervention for addressing ill health concerns arising from underweight, overweight, or obesity.
